Aberdeen Court - streets of Annandale (Virginia).
Explore "Aberdeen Court" on the map of Annandale in street view mode
Click on the buttons below to display the map of Aberdeen Court, Annandale, United States
Search street by name:
Tags:
Aberdeen Court on the map of Annandale,
Annandale satellite view, Annandale street view.